Stargate SG-1
"Missing Angel"
Chapter 6
Jack O'Neill sat on the roof of his house, it was the one thing he enjoyed about retirement. Being able to get up on his roof every night and look up at the stars. But it was not quite dark enough to see all the stars, yet. The moon was out, but that was all that was visable yet so early. He heard his ladder rustle beside him, he looked and saw Jacob Carter climbing up. "I'll come down," Jack said starting to climb down. "I wasn't expecting you, Jacob."
"No, but George told me that I should come see you. That you and I would have alot to talk about."
"Such as?"
"My daughter."
"How is Sam doing?"
"The same, but George won't keep her on life support if she gets worse."
"What about that vaccine Doc Frasier's been working on?"
"Apparently the whole Roshna synthesized or vaccination has become totally hopeless."
"Have they given up?"
"No."
"Then it's not hopeless."
"Jack, about Sam."
"Yes?"
"I know that there are some feelings between you two."
"Feelings? No. I'm her commanding officer it's against regulations."
"I know, but that doesn't mean you can't have those feelings."
"Even if I did, I can't do anything about it."
"Does she know?"
"Okay. Yes she knows."
"Have you told her?"
"No, but she knows how I feel."
"Tell her Jack. I understand that you lost your son. Don't you ever wish you could have said something else to him?"
"Yes."
"Sam lost her mother, and I know that I wish that I could go back in time and tell her just one last time that I love her, but I can't. But Jack you have time."
"I'm just afraid that if I say it, then she'll die and I don't know what I'll do."
"Tell her Jack, just tell her."
"I miss Charlie."
"I know. I know."
______________________________________________________________________
"How about the Asguard? Don't they owe us for saving them or something?" Colonel O'Neill asked aloud.
"Actually we sort of already called in that marker," Daniel told him.
"When?"
"When we shifted that sun to red from the planetary alignment and us traveling through the stargate. Remember Freyer?"
"Does that count?"
"I believe so, O'Neill," Teal'c answered.
"Well then maybe they can do us a favor."
"But how do we contact the Asguard?" Hammond asked.
"Well maybe Cart--well maybe she left notes on how to put one of those extra power for the gate thing?"
"Cimmeria!"
"What about it?"
"Maybe we can contact Thor from there?"
"Isn't that a recording?"
"He saved the people of Cimmeria, so he must know what people babble to the recording, right?"
"I guess we're off to Cimmeria, them."
"Colonel O'Neill shouldn't you be asking me first?" General Hammond asked.
"General?"
"I'm letting you go, but with one exception."
"What?"
"Major Wayfield goes with you."
"Who?"
"Just transferred here. Sam Wayfield."
"Sam? Samantha?"
"No, Samuel. He's a physicist."
"Another scientist, General?"
"That's my only way to let you go."
"Fine, but I don't have to like him."
"That's fine, but he's still going and he'll attend any further SG-1 missions until Major Carter is well again."
"Yes, sir."
"Dismissed."
